Comprehensive Guide to Ohio Recreation Permit
What is the Ohio Recreational Users Permit?
The Ohio Recreational Users Permit is a government form issued by the Ohio Department of Natural Resources in collaboration with American Electric Power (AEP). This permit is essential for those who wish to engage in outdoor activities across AEP's Public Recreation Lands. It grants permission for activities such as camping, fishing, and hunting, making it significant for outdoor enthusiasts seeking to enjoy Ohio's natural resources.

Who is eligible for the Ohio Recreational Users Permit?
The Ohio Recreational Users Permit is available to all Ohio residents, families, and organizations wishing to access American Electric Power's Public Recreation Lands for recreational activities.
What activities can I use the permit for?
The permit allows holders to participate in a variety of outdoor activities such as camping, hunting, fishing, trapping, and other recreational uses on designated lands.

Do I need to notarize the Ohio Recreational Users Permit?
No, the Ohio Recreational Users Permit does not require notarization, but it must be signed and dated by the permit holder to be valid.
